Hyrox is taking the fitness world by storm. The race was inspired by millions of athletes around the world who consider functional fitness as their sport of choice. Until now there was no measurable fitness race for everybody.
Hyrox is the ultimate challenge, a perfect combination between strength, endurance and determination. The event sees participants take on 8x 1km runs and 8 functional workouts, testing both strength and endurance.

As with all challenges, there has to be a cause, and the two of them have been fundraising in support of Macmillan Cancer Support. Macmillan is one of the largest British charities and provides specialist health care, information and financial support to people affected by cancer.
Right now, more than 3 million people are living with cancer in the UK, Macmillan aims to help everyone with cancer live life as fully as they can, by providing physical, financial and emotional support.
